The First Few Days After Surgery
It’s completely normal to experience mild discomfort, swelling, or tenderness after hemorrhoid surgery. These symptoms are temporary and show that your body is healing.
Here’s what you can typically expect:
-
Mild Pain or Sensitivity: Managed easily with prescribed medication.
-
Minor Bleeding: Especially during bowel movements in the first week.
-
Swelling or Discomfort: Improves steadily with proper care.
-
Fatigue: Give your body rest — it’s part of recovery.
Most patients feel significantly better within a few days, though complete healing may take two to four weeks, depending on the type of surgery performed.
Practical Tips for a Smooth Recovery
1. Follow Post-Operative Instructions Carefully
Your doctor will provide personalized care guidelines — including how to clean the surgical site, manage pain, and avoid complications. Follow these instructions closely for the best results.
2. Keep the Area Clean
Gently wash the anal area with warm water after bowel movements and pat dry with a soft towel. Avoid harsh soaps or wipes that can irritate the skin.
3. Eat Fiber-Rich Foods
A di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ains helps prevent constipation, which can strain healing tissues. You can also take fiber supplements if recommended by your doctor.
4. Stay Hydrated
Drink plenty of water throughout the day to keep stools soft and reduce pressure during bowel movements.
5. Avoid Straining or Heavy Lifting
Take it easy for the first couple of weeks. Avoid strenuous exercise, long sitting periods, or lifting heavy objects until your doctor clears you to resume normal activities.
6. Use Sitz Baths
Soaking in warm water for 10–15 minutes a few times daily can soothe pain, reduce swelling, and promote faster healing.
When to Contact Your Doctor
While most patients recover smoothly, contact your healthcare provider immediately if you experience:
-
Excessive bleeding
-
Severe or worsening pain
-
Signs of infection (fever, pus, or foul odor)
-
Difficulty urinating or bowel movements
Prompt medical attention ensures any minor issue is managed before it becomes serious.

Long-Term Care and Prevention
To prevent hemorrhoids from returning after surgery, maintain healthy habits:
-
Continue a fiber-rich diet
-
Stay active and avoid sitting for long periods
-
Maintain a healthy weight
-
Go to the bathroom as soon as you feel the urge — don’t delay bowel movements
These small daily choices help you stay healthy and protect your results.
